A thermoacoustic device 1 for reliably generating standing and traveling waves, which have a large sound pressure, in a loop tube, has a loop tube 2 in which a working fluid is sealed; first stacks 3 a, each of which has a plurality of communication paths 30 along a heat transportation direction and is provided between a first high-temperature side heat exchanger 4 and a first low-temperature side heat exchanger 5, which are provided in this loop tube 2; and a second stack 3 b which has a plurality of communication paths 30 along a heat transportation direction and which is provided between a second high-temperature side heat exchanger 6 and a second low-temperature side heat exchanger 7, which are provided in the loop tube 2, and in the thermoacoustic device 1, self-excited standing and traveling waves are generated by heating the first high-temperature side heat exchanger 4, so that the second low-temperature side heat exchanger 7 is cooled by the standing and traveling waves. The first stacks 3 a each provided between the first high-temperature side heat exchanger 4 and the first low-temperature side heat exchanger 5 are provided at a plurality of positions which are in the vicinities at which the phase of change in acoustic particle velocity is the same as the phase of change in sound pressure.
